A Better Alternative!
There is a growing development towards electrification and an ever-increasing demand for more energy-efficient alternate options to compressed air systems. The major components for consideration when deciding on the ideal different actuator type tend to be cost, risk, efficiency and availability.
Cost reduction
Electric valves provide significantly higher efficiency, and consequently a better vitality steadiness, in comparison with pneumatic techniques. The discount to a single energy type ends in price financial savings via decrease set up and maintenance necessities. Additionally, the system availability is elevated, since potential faults are decreased.
Risk discount
In the pharmaceutical/biotechnology industries, the important course of steps require sterile compressed air. The era of sterile compressed air along with the sterilising functionality of the whole system must be considered. Electrical valves can get rid of the danger of contamination. In regard to industrial functions, if contaminated compressed air gets into the system or if there are fluctuations within the compressed air community, it might possibly lead to irreparable malfunctioning of pneumatic parts.
เกจ์ลมsumo to their precise management techniques with no overshooting and independence from the medium stress, motorized valves are a becoming selection for control functions. In conjunction with a particularly excessive positioning accuracy, this results in considerable increases in productivity. A wide selection of parameterization and diagnostic services that form the basis for growing digitalization are often a part of electrical valves (industry four.zero applications).
Availability
In many areas of software, there is merely no compressed air obtainable for a broad variety of reasons. In contrast to this, electrical energy is virtually ubiquitous – electrically operated valves can be used nearly wherever in the facility.
The right selection of valve
GEMÜ presents an extensive vary of electrical valves for a extensive variety of purposes.
The GEMÜ R629 eSyLite is a low-cost diaphragm valve for easy and cost-sensitive purposes. It constitutes a cost-effective alternative to solenoid valves made from plastic or motorized plastic ball valves. Alternatively, GEMÜ eSyStep valves are designed for standard open/closed and easy control applications, that includes a compact spindle actuator with step motor and can be mounted with electrical position indicators or journey sensors.
For variable and complicated open/closed and management applications, GEMÜ eSyDrive is more appropriate. Designed on the basis of the hollow shaft principle at the side of know-how that does not use brushes/sensors, the eSyDrive actuator units new requirements by method of service life, compactness, actuating speed and vitality effectivity. The self-locking actuator also offers a excessive level of reproducibility for positioning and is subsequently perfect for use in control purposes.
